

In a little meadow, where the sun shone all day, there lived a tiny bee named Beatrice.

:)


Beatrice spent most days buzzing around the meadow, making honey, and eating snacks.
call me Bea!



Beatrice had a big family. They all lived in a hive in the meadow.


Beatrice's parents loved her very much. They showed her how to make honey and took care of her when she was sick.




When Beatrice was a baby bee, her parents told her all about the hive. When Beatrice grew up, they said, she would join the hive and start making honey too!





Beatrice was so excited to start making honey with her friends and her family. She couldn't wait to grow up and get bigger!




i want to get big!
be patient, Bea!
When Beatrice's wings got big enough to fly up to the hive, she started making honey! Her whole hive taught her the ropes.

finally!!

Beatrice thought she would love making honey. It's what she had been looking forward to her whole life, after all!

hmm.. making honey is hard!

But Beatrice didn't love being in the hive as much as she thought she would. It was tiring, and her mind wandered all over the place as she worked.

zzz.....
Beatrice was worried. Why wasn't she happy?
She kept thinking about how she'd rather be doing something else.

what's wrong with me?!
That day after hive time, she really thought about what she enjoyed doing. Before she was old enough for hive time, she did a lot of baking...

I do love baking!!! Hmm..



She always used the honey from her family's hive to make sweet treats, and give them out to her hive after they worked hard.

Here, have a honey cupcake! I made it myself!

thanks, Bea! yum!

Maybe she could be a baker instead of working in the hive all day! She decided to ask her parents what they thought.

I can make cupcakes all day!

Bea's parents were not happy.
"Bea, you have to work in the hive. That's what you were born to do," they told her.

bees are meant to be in a hive!
not in a bakery! don't be silly!



Bea was nothing if not stubborn.
"I'll show them!" she thought. "I'll bake them the best treats in the world!"

I'll change their minds! I want to be a baker!
She put on her little bee-sized chef's hat and got to work.


First she had to get some honey from the hive to bake with. She enlisted her best friend Buzz's help; she promised him a honey croissant.



Buzz, I need your help!
what's in it for me?

Once Buzz knew Bea would bake him a honey croissant, he immediately got the honey for her.
"Here's your honey! I'll be waiting for my croissant!"



here's a honeycomb!

thanks, Buzz! You're the best!

Beatrice got to work! She had no time to waste!
She got her trusty whisk and started baking.




Beatrice worked day and night. She had to bake enough treats for the whole entire hive!
She whisked, stirred, measured, and tasted.











While she was baking, she felt so happy. She knew she was at home in the kitchen, not in the hive.











I am so content!
When she was done, she had honey cookies, honey cupcakes, honey croissants, and even a tasty honey cake with honey frosting! She was proud of herself.












She decided to take her treats up to the hive and feed all her friends and family. She couldn't wait to see their faces when they tried her baking!












All of her bee friends scarfed down her treats.
"These are the best honey cookies in the world, Beatrice!" they all said.







yum!!
Then Beatrice saw her parents. They didn't look mad, just uncertain.
"I want to bake, not be in the hive," Bea told them.







Bea, what are you doing?
"Everyone loves my treats! Baking is when I'm happiest," she explained. "Plus, I'm good at it! Try one of my honey cupcakes. You'll see."








They took a nibble apprehensively.
"WOW!" Bea's mom buzzed. "This is the best honey cupcake I've ever had!"







.

"We can see how hard you've worked. And how talented you are. We want you to be in the hive, but we understand you won't be happy there," she said.







I'm so glad you like them!
